Sonar X2 Essential - will this be ok for me ?
Hi Many years ago I used an old version of Sonar and I'm now wanting to purchase a newer package to use on Windows 7. I used the software to record Midi tracks from my keyboard, using the stave/score view mainly, so that I could see an arrangement building up on screen, track by track. like looking at sheet music. I cant seem to find much detailed information on the Essential package. Can anyone confirm that it is capable of displaying a score, as my old version did ? Thanks in advance Chris

John Sonar X2 wil work fine for recording a MIDI keyboard and displaying the notes in the staff view. I'm using Essential and it's doing just fine. (Should I run into some extra cash, I may upgrade..) There aren't too many limitations at all. Of course, you do not get those fine ProChannel modules, but that's not a game-stopper at this level. You don't get nearly as many synths and plug-ins either, but that is the bargain we are opting for. My only wish is that control surface automation recording wasn't limited to 'touch' mode only - but then again recording automation just might properly be considered a bit beyond the basic user's normal repertoire.
